When viewing a log file in the log file viewer, the display jumps to the bottom of the log when new messages are written to the log. This is desired behaviour if the display is at the bottom of the file already, however if I am trying to read part of the middle of the log file I do not want it to jump to the end. The viewer should only scroll to the bottom if the scrollbar was already at the bottom before the new message appeared.
